2. Lifestyle & Amenities
Life in Monkey Box revolves around the great outdoors and community-centric living. The Pahokee Marina & Campground is a local hub, offering boat ramps for access to world-class bass fishing on Lake Okeechobee, often called "The Big O." The Lake Okeechobee Scenic Trail, part of the larger Florida National Scenic Trail, is perfect for walking, biking, and taking in panoramic water views. Community parks host local events and provide spaces for family gatherings.
While the area is peaceful and rural, the city of Pahokee provides essential amenities including grocery stores, local restaurants serving hearty fare, and healthcare facilities. For more extensive shopping or entertainment, residents take short drives to nearby towns like Belle Glade. The lifestyle here is for those who find fulfillment in fishing, boating, sunsets, and a genuine, unpretentious community spirit.
3. Real Estate Market
The real estate market in Monkey Box and greater Pahokee is one of the most affordable in all of Florida. The median home value here is approximately $85,000, offering incredible opportunities for homeownership, especially for first-time buyers or those seeking a modest, low-cost retreat. Properties range from cozy, older Florida homes on spacious lots to mobile homes and newer constructions, often with ample yard space.
This affordability, combined with the area's natural assets, makes it an attractive option for retirees, outdoor enthusiasts, and remote workers seeking a change of pace. The market reflects the area's lower cost of living, with the median household income around $36,043. 4. Schools & Education
Families in the Monkey Box area are served by the Palm Beach County School District. Students typically attend Pahokee Elementary School, Pahokee Middle School, and Pahokee High School, all located within the city. These community schools are focal points for local pride, with Pahokee High School's Blue Devils athletics, especially football, drawing strong community support and having a storied history of producing top-tier talent.
The schools offer a range of academic and extracurricular programs with the benefit of smaller class sizes and a close-knit environment. For higher education, Palm Beach State College has a campus in nearby Belle Glade, providing accessible associate degrees and vocational training. 5. Transportation & Connectivity
Monkey Box is accessible via State Road 715, which connects directly to Pahokee and to major highways like State Road 80 and U.S. Highway 441. A car is essential for daily life and for trips to larger commercial centers like West Palm Beach, which is about a 45-minute to an hour's drive east. The area offers a feeling of being "away from it all" while remaining within a reasonable distance of urban necessities.
Palm Tran provides limited public bus service connecting Pahokee to other Glades communities and beyond. The nearby Palm Beach International Airport (PBI) is the primary air travel hub for residents. Monkey Box Market Data
| Metric | Value | Source |
|---|---|---|
| Median Home Price | $85K | U.S. Census ACS 2022 |
| Median Gross Rent | $781/mo | U.S. Census ACS 2022 |
| Median Household Income | $36K | U.S. Census ACS 2022 |
| Homeownership Rate | 71.3% | U.S. Census ACS 2022 |
| Renter-Occupied | 28.7% | U.S. Census ACS 2022 |
| Rental Vacancy Rate | 2.9% | U.S. Census ACS 2022 |
| Market Type | Seller's | U.S. Census ACS 2022 |
| Primary ZIP Code | 33471 |
